Publisher's Synopsis

'Nana' is an evocation of the glittering, corrupt world of the Second French Empire, where prostitution played an important part at all levels.

About the Publisher

Penguin Classics

In January 1946, the Penguin Classics list was launched with E. V. Rieu's translation of The Odyssey. The series now consists of over 800 titles including the best in English, American, European, classical and non-western literature and an extensive range of philosophy, religion, art, history and politics titles.
